How can I remove mold from leather boots?


Question:I live in the south with lots of humidity, mold on leather is fairly common, but what is the best way to remove it with out hurting the leather?

leather shoes should be aired and dried after brushing off mold. Make a mixture of 1 cup denatured alcohol and 1 cup water. Dip a cloth in this mixture and wring it out. Rub mildew spots gently. Dry well. You can also use saddle soap. Dry and air well before storing.
